On Wednesday, December 5th, California’s Long Beach Airport (LGB) will unveil an expanded and upgraded passenger concourse in its Art Deco style terminal building, complete with a garden court and new local retail outlets and eateries. Of special interest are the Works Progress Administration (WPA) mosaics by Grace Clements that were (re)discovered when the maintenance […]

The SFO Museum at San Francisco International Airport has a fun, fab new exhibit featuring advertising used to promote blue jeans from Levi Strauss & Co. as early as 1873. From Art Nouveau to Pop Day-Glo: Levi Strauss Advertising As Art features art and ephemera from the company’s archives, including catalog covers, salesman’s flyers, calendars […]
